Best pub in the area with a large selection of craft ales on tap, you won't find any big name beers here. Plus a good selection of take away cans and bottles. Relaxed atmosphere, quite background music only and rarely any TV's on lovely spacious interior and a small beer garden. Average Β£6:50 for a keg beer, draft is cheaper though at around Β£4.80 a pint, they all taste fantastic, so I keep coming back. Staff always nice, my go to pub in the area.

Fantastic spacious pub, with some interesting windows and mirrors. Huge range of stunning craft beer, including several imperial stouts all on tap. Half a dozen or so cask ales, I only had one ( stayed in the kegged beers for the rest ), but it was in fantastic condition, a beautiful chocolate orange stout. Also had a bottle corner, with some great lambic and gueuze selection.

This is a very nice pub with a great selection of drinks on tap, like a VERY wide selection. Thankfully, if you're not into your craft ales and ciders then they usually have 1 nice lager on tap, think it's Pilsner Urquell. They also have quite an impressive selection of spirits. They also do takeaway drinks.The staff are friendly, helpful and attentive. The place is usually very warm (physically). They have a small beer garden to the rear of the pub. The place is very clean, comfortable and usually quiet if you fancy a chat.
